| Aspect | Parts Distribution | Parts Inventory Specialist |
|---|
| Primary Role | Distributes parts to customers or technicians, manages shipping and logistics | Maintains and manages inventory levels, tracks stock, and orders parts |
| Work Environment | Warehouse, distribution centers, logistics settings | Stockrooms, warehouses, inventory management systems |
| Credentials | Often requires a high school diploma, forklift or logistics certifications | High school diploma or equivalent, inventory management certifications |
| Industry Usage | Used across automotive, manufacturing, and repair industries | Common in automotive, machinery, and equipment sectors |
While both roles involve handling parts, Parts Distribution focuses on delivering and shipping parts to customers or technicians, whereas Parts Inventory Specialist manages stock levels and inventory accuracy. Both roles are essential in supply chain operations within similar industries, often working closely together to ensure parts availability and timely delivery.
